A nuclear stress test is an imaging test that shows how blood goes to the heart at rest and during exercise. It uses a small amount of radioactive material, called a tracer or radiotracer. The substance is given by IV. An imaging machine takes pictures of how the tracer moves through the heart arteries. This helps find areas of poor blood flow ...Cardiac stress testing is the most commonly used modality for diagnostic purposes in patients with known or suspected coronary artery disease (CAD). The utility of stress testing should be interpreted based on the likelihood of the disease. Young, CPC, CEDC, CIMC. When reported to Medicare, cardiac (93015-93024) and pulmonary (94620-94621) stress tests must meet applicable supervision requirements. You also must remember that in the outpatient setting only a physician—never a non-physician practitioner (NPP)—may act as the supervising entity for diagnostic tests.

Oct 20, 2020 · Follow 5 Rules When Reporting Stress Echoes With Stress Tests. A cardiac stress test is one component of the stress echo. When a stress echo is performed, the cardiologist will take echocardiographic images of the wall of the left heart before, after, and sometimes during the stress test to monitor the motion and thickening of specific walls, according to CPT ® Assistant.

You can bill CVS stress test codes 93016 and 93018 with 93350, when performed. Append appropriate modifiers where needed. However, you can cannot report 93350 with the 93015 global stress test code. Also, 93351 (TTE global code) cannot be billed with 93350 or other cardiovascular stress codes i.e., 93015-93018 codes, as per CPT coding guidelines.

When to use CPT code 93016. It is appropriate to bill CPT code 93016 when a healthcare provider supervises a cardiovascular stress test using exercise or pharmacological stress, with continuous ECG monitoring, but does not interpret the data or create a report.
